  1. import io
  2. import logging
  3. import uuid
  4. from collections.abc import Generator
  5. from typing import Optional
  6. from flask import Response, stream_with_context
  7. from werkzeug.datastructures import FileStorage
  8. from constants import AUDIO_EXTENSIONS
  9. from core.model_manager import ModelManager
  10. from core.model_runtime.entities.model_entities import ModelType
  11. from extensions.ext_database import db
  12. from models.enums import MessageStatus
  13. from models.model import App, AppMode, Message
  14. from services.errors.audio import (
  15. AudioTooLargeServiceError,
  16. NoAudioUploadedServiceError,
  17. ProviderNotSupportSpeechToTextServiceError,
  18. ProviderNotSupportTextToSpeechServiceError,
  19. UnsupportedAudioTypeServiceError,
  20. )
  21. from services.workflow_service import WorkflowService
  22. FILE_SIZE = 30
  23. FILE_SIZE_LIMIT = FILE_SIZE * 1024 * 1024
  24. logger = logging.getLogger(__name__)
  25. class AudioService:
  26. @classmethod
  27. def transcript_asr(cls, app_model: App, file: FileStorage, end_user: Optional[str] = None):
  28. if app_model.mode in {AppMode.ADVANCED_CHAT, AppMode.WORKFLOW}:
  29. workflow = app_model.workflow
  30. if workflow is None:
  31. raise ValueError("Speech to text is not enabled")
  32. features_dict = workflow.features_dict
  33. if "speech_to_text" not in features_dict or not features_dict["speech_to_text"].get("enabled"):
  34. raise ValueError("Speech to text is not enabled")
  35. else:
  36. app_model_config = app_model.app_model_config
  37. if not app_model_config:
  38. raise ValueError("Speech to text is not enabled")
  39. if not app_model_config.speech_to_text_dict["enabled"]:
  40. raise ValueError("Speech to text is not enabled")
  41. if file is None:
  42. raise NoAudioUploadedServiceError()
  43. extension = file.mimetype
  44. if extension not in [f"audio/{ext}" for ext in AUDIO_EXTENSIONS]:
  45. raise UnsupportedAudioTypeServiceError()
  46. file_content = file.read()
  47. file_size = len(file_content)
  48. if file_size > FILE_SIZE_LIMIT:
  49. message = f"Audio size larger than {FILE_SIZE} mb"
  50. raise AudioTooLargeServiceError(message)
  51. model_manager = ModelManager()
  52. model_instance = model_manager.get_default_model_instance(
  53. tenant_id=app_model.tenant_id, model_type=ModelType.SPEECH2TEXT
  54. )
  55. if model_instance is None:
  56. raise ProviderNotSupportSpeechToTextServiceError()
  57. buffer = io.BytesIO(file_content)
  58. buffer.name = "temp.mp3"
  59. return {"text": model_instance.invoke_speech2text(file=buffer, user=end_user)}
  60. @classmethod
  61. def transcript_tts(
  62. cls,
  63. app_model: App,
  64. text: Optional[str] = None,
  65. voice: Optional[str] = None,
  66. end_user: Optional[str] = None,
  67. message_id: Optional[str] = None,
  68. is_draft: bool = False,
  69. ):
  70. from app import app
  71. def invoke_tts(text_content: str, app_model: App, voice: Optional[str] = None, is_draft: bool = False):
  72. with app.app_context():
  73. if voice is None:
  74. if app_model.mode in {AppMode.ADVANCED_CHAT, AppMode.WORKFLOW}:
  75. if is_draft:
  76. workflow = WorkflowService().get_draft_workflow(app_model=app_model)
  77. else:
  78. workflow = app_model.workflow
  79. if (
  80. workflow is None
  81. or "text_to_speech" not in workflow.features_dict
  82. or not workflow.features_dict["text_to_speech"].get("enabled")
  83. ):
  84. raise ValueError("TTS is not enabled")
  85. voice = workflow.features_dict["text_to_speech"].get("voice")
  86. else:
  87. if not is_draft:
  88. if app_model.app_model_config is None:
  89. raise ValueError("AppModelConfig not found")
  90. text_to_speech_dict = app_model.app_model_config.text_to_speech_dict
  91. if not text_to_speech_dict.get("enabled"):
  92. raise ValueError("TTS is not enabled")
  93. voice = text_to_speech_dict.get("voice")
  94. model_manager = ModelManager()
  95. model_instance = model_manager.get_default_model_instance(
  96. tenant_id=app_model.tenant_id, model_type=ModelType.TTS
  97. )
  98. try:
  99. if not voice:
  100. voices = model_instance.get_tts_voices()
  101. if voices:
  102. voice = voices[0].get("value")
  103. if not voice:
  104. raise ValueError("Sorry, no voice available.")
  105. else:
  106. raise ValueError("Sorry, no voice available.")
  107. return model_instance.invoke_tts(
  108. content_text=text_content.strip(), user=end_user, tenant_id=app_model.tenant_id, voice=voice
  109. )
  110. except Exception as e:
  111. raise e
  112. if message_id:
  113. try:
  114. uuid.UUID(message_id)
  115. except ValueError:
  116. return None
  117. message = db.session.query(Message).where(Message.id == message_id).first()
  118. if message is None:
  119. return None
  120. if message.answer == "" and message.status == MessageStatus.NORMAL:
  121. return None
  122. else:
  123. response = invoke_tts(text_content=message.answer, app_model=app_model, voice=voice, is_draft=is_draft)
  124. if isinstance(response, Generator):
  125. return Response(stream_with_context(response), content_type="audio/mpeg")
  126. return response
  127. else:
  128. if text is None:
  129. raise ValueError("Text is required")
  130. response = invoke_tts(text_content=text, app_model=app_model, voice=voice, is_draft=is_draft)
  131. if isinstance(response, Generator):
  132. return Response(stream_with_context(response), content_type="audio/mpeg")
  133. return response
  134. @classmethod
  135. def transcript_tts_voices(cls, tenant_id: str, language: str):
  136. model_manager = ModelManager()
  137. model_instance = model_manager.get_default_model_instance(tenant_id=tenant_id, model_type=ModelType.TTS)
  138. if model_instance is None:
  139. raise ProviderNotSupportTextToSpeechServiceError()
  140. try:
  141. return model_instance.get_tts_voices(language)
  142. except Exception as e:
  143. raise e
